mirror of
https://github.com/Rockbox/rockbox.git
synced 2025-12-09 05:05:20 -05:00
Disabled all code for the serial remote on Ondio, since the serial port is needed for MMC access.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@5097 a1c6a512-1295-4272-9138-f99709370657
This commit is contained in:
parent
57945b125d
commit
2d875f83e6
3 changed files with 10 additions and 1 deletions
|
|
@ -127,7 +127,10 @@ void init(void)
|
|||
#ifdef DEBUG
|
||||
debug_init();
|
||||
#else
|
||||
#ifndef HAVE_MMC /* FIXME: This is also necessary for debug builds
|
||||
* (do debug builds on the Ondio make sense?) */
|
||||
serial_setup();
|
||||
#endif
|
||||
#endif
|
||||
|
||||
i2c_init();
|
||||
|
|
|
|||
|
|
@ -67,12 +67,14 @@ static void button_tick(void)
|
|||
int diff;
|
||||
int btn;
|
||||
|
||||
#ifndef HAVE_MMC
|
||||
/* Post events for the remote control */
|
||||
btn = remote_control_rx();
|
||||
if(btn)
|
||||
{
|
||||
queue_post(&button_queue, btn, NULL);
|
||||
}
|
||||
#endif
|
||||
|
||||
/* only poll every X ticks */
|
||||
if ( ++tick >= POLL_FREQUENCY )
|
||||
|
|
|
|||
|
|
@ -27,6 +27,8 @@
|
|||
#include "lcd.h"
|
||||
#include "serial.h"
|
||||
|
||||
#ifndef HAVE_MMC /* MMC takes serial port 1, so don't mess with it */
|
||||
|
||||
/* Received byte identifiers */
|
||||
#define PLAY 0xC1
|
||||
#define STOP 0xC2
|
||||
|
|
@ -133,3 +135,5 @@ int remote_control_rx(void)
|
|||
|
||||
return ret;
|
||||
}
|
||||
|
||||
#endif /* HAVE_MMC */
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ue